How to prepare for a job interview at All Saints

✨Know Your Teaching Philosophy

Before the interview, take some time to reflect on your teaching philosophy. Be ready to discuss how it aligns with the school's commitment to active and experiential learning. This will show that you’re not just a good teacher, but a great fit for their approach.

✨Prepare Examples of Your Impact

Think of specific examples where you've successfully assessed pupil progress and adapted your teaching accordingly. Sharing these stories will demonstrate your ability to lead strong teaching and contribute to the school’s improvement work.

✨Show Enthusiasm for Collaboration

Since the school values teamwork and collaboration, be prepared to discuss how you’ve worked with colleagues in the past. Highlight any training or professional development experiences that showcase your commitment to continuous improvement.

✨Build Rapport with Interviewers

During the interview, focus on building positive relationships with your interviewers. Use their names, maintain eye contact, and engage in friendly conversation. This will reflect your ability to connect with pupils, families, and colleagues in the school environment.
